Brief Summary

Familial mediterranean fever (FMF) is common in mediterranean region. this disorder is connected with deterioration in functional performance, fitness of cardiorespiration, muscle strength, and bone mass

Study Arms (2)

vibration group

EXPERIMENTAL

vibration group OF FMF will contain 20 FMF adolescent girls. who will receive vitamin D and their traditional colchicine doses daily for six months. vibration group will receive also three sessions of 20-min whole body vibration in the week for 6 months

Other: whole body vibration plus usual care

control group

ACTIVE COMPARATOR

control group of Familial mediterranean fever (20 FMF adolescent girls ) will receive vitamin D and their traditional colchicine doses daily for six months.

Other: usual care
